GRADY WILSON, MEMBER OF BILLY GRAHAM EVANGELISTIC TEAM, DIES AT 68
MINNEAPOLIS, Oct. 31 /PRNewswire/ -- Grady B. Wilson, 68, of Charlotte, the first Associate Evangelist Billy Graham picked for his evangelistic team, died yesterday in a Charlotte hospital.
Graham stated today: "Grady Wilson was one of my closest friends and associates for over 50 years. No one outside of my family has ever been any closer than Grady. He was a unique servant of God. I doubt if there will ever be another one like him. He had friends all over the world. He was at home with the rich and the poor, and counted three presidents as his friend, but he was always the same. ...
